How they compare

United States of America currently reports 241.07 million kg against 332,269 kg in Syrian Arab Republic, a difference of 240.74 million kg.

That makes United States of America's figure about 725.5 times Syrian Arab Republic's.

Across all 63 years both countries report, United States of America has been ahead every year.

Syrian Arab Republic ranks 16th and United States of America ranks 15th of 17 countries.

United States of America has averaged higher in every one of the 7 decades both report.

The Livestock Manure domain of FAOSTAT contains estimates of nitrogen (N) inputs to agricultural soils from livestock manure. Data on the N losses to air and water are also disseminated. These estimates are compiled using official FAOSTAT statistics of animal stocks and by applying the internationally approved Guidelines of the Intergovernmental Panel on Climate Change (IPCC). Data are available by country, with global coverage and updated annually.The following elements are disseminated: 1) Stocks; 2) Amount excreted in manure (N content); 3) Manure left on pasture (N content); 4) Manure left on pasture that volatilises (N content); 5) Manure left on pasture that leaches (N content); 6) Manure treated (N content); 7) Losses from manure treated (N content); 8) Manure applied to soils (N content); 9) Manure applied to soils that volatilises (N content); 10) Manure applied to soils that leaches (N content).
